Title :
Information extraction of mining-land use based on automatic threshold classification of decision tree

Abstract :
This paper presents automatic threshold classification of decision tree. Taking Lu´an mine area as an example, the land use information from 1993 and 2000 year´s TM images are extracted. The classification results reach relevant accuracy requirements, from which 1993-2000 conversion matrix of land use is attained. That will help to analyze the causes of the land-use changes so as to provide a strong basis for mining-land reclamation planning.
